智能推荐
1.1 单行推荐
单行推荐是在续写代码场景中最直接、最高效的体现方式。在打开一个代码文件后,开始编码。在编码过程中稍微等待一下,即可看到 Comate 的推荐内容。

如果觉得推荐内容不错,即可使用 Tab 键采纳,否则可以使用 ESC 键取消推荐。此外,在 Visual Studio Code 中,还可以按单词采纳部分推荐,方便按您的意图修改代码。

以下是 Comate 常用操作的快捷方式,若您是第一次使用,Comate 会在推荐内容后展示快捷键提示。
| 操作 | macOS | Windows | 
|---|---|---|
| 采纳推荐 | Tab | Tab | 
| 取消推荐 | esc | esc | 
| 查看上一推荐 | ⌥[ | Alt[ | 
| 查看下一推荐 | ⌥] | Alt] | 
| 按单词部分采纳推荐(仅适用于 Visual Studio Code) | ⌘→ | Ctrl→ | 
| 唤起对话框(Visual Studio Code) | ⌘Y | Windows徽标键Y | 
| 唤起对话框(JetBrains IDEs) | ⌘ShiftY | CtrlShiftY | 
1.2 多行推荐
多行推荐与单行推荐的使用方式一致。在符合多行推荐的条件下(如 {( 处、for 循环、if 判断等),Comate 会优先计算一次多行推荐逻辑。如果逻辑完整,则会展示多行推荐结果。

1.3 行间提示
在出现推荐内容后,鼠标移动到推荐内容上则会出现行间提示。行间提示用于展示更多能力、方便鼠标点按操作。

